This 2006 Sea Ray 340 Sportsman represents the ultimate blend of luxury express cruising and versatile open-water functionality. Built on one of Sea Ray’s most successful express hulls, the Sportsman package enhances the legendary 340 platform with an open, multipurpose cockpit layout featuring dual transom walk-throughs and a fold-away aft bench. Whether you are coastal cruising, entertaining a crowd at the anchor, or heading out for a casual day on the water, this vessel delivers an exceptionally smooth ride and premium amenities throughout.
Vessel Overview
Stepping aboard, the 340 Sportsman immediately impresses with its generous 12-foot beam and sleek profile. The wide beam translates to incredible stability offshore and unmatched interior volume for a vessel in the 34-foot class. Powered by reliable twin MerCruiser V-drive inboards, she offers effortless planing, comfortable mid-20-knot cruising speeds, and responsive close-quarters handling around the dock.
Cockpit & Deck Architecture
The cockpit is purposefully designed to maximize usable deck space while retaining all the upscale comfort Sea Ray is known for. The helm area features companion bucket seating with flip-up thigh-rise bolsters, elevating visibility while under way. A starboard wet bar with solid-surface countertops, built-in ice chest, and dedicated storage keeps refreshments easily accessible. Aft, the open cockpit layout provides ample room for social gatherings or gear setup, complete with snap-in marine carpet, indirect courtesy lighting, a hot and cold transom shower, and an integrated swim platform with a hidden stainless steel boarding ladder.
Cabin & Accommodations
Below deck, the cabin showcases Sea Ray’s classic craftsmanship, highlighted by high-gloss cherry cabinetry, rich upholstery, and solid Corian countertops. Seven opening portlights and overhead deck hatches flood the interior with natural light. The forward stateroom features an island double berth with a memory foam mattress, fitted privacy curtains, and dual hanging lockers.
The main salon includes a plush sofa that easily converts to an additional sleeping area alongside a dining table. Opposite the salon, the full-service galley comes well-equipped with a dual-voltage refrigerator/freezer, a recessed two-burner electric stove, a microwave/coffeemaker combo, and generous drawer and overhead storage. Aft of the main salon, the mid-cabin conversation pit serves as a cozy lounge by day and converts to a private double berth for overnight guests. A fully enclosed head with a VacuFlush toilet, molded vanity, and integrated shower completes the interior accommodations.
Mechanical & Electrical Systems
Engineered for reliable performance and effortless weekending, the engine compartment is accessible via an electric hatch lifter for easy maintenance. Onboard systems are powered by a marine generator and a multi-bank battery charging system, ensuring seamless power whether underway or anchored off the grid. Climate control is provided by a reverse-cycle air conditioning and heating system, keeping the cabin comfortable in any season.
